How to Spot Fake Players in Live Casinos

fake live casino player

I’ve seen bettors make perfect decisions every time as if they know the outcome. That’s not how real gamblers play.

Then there are the weird betting patterns. Some players go all-in at the perfect moment, right before the dealer busts.

It happens once, maybe it’s luck. When the same account keeps making flawless bets, something is not kosher. Are they real players, or just a casino stunt to hype up the game?

The chatroom can be another concern. I’ve seen messages that feel robotic. Like someone copy-pasting generic phrases: “Wow, big win again!” or “This dealer is on fire!”

Real players have personalities. They complain. They joke. If the chat feels staged, run! I’m not saying every live casino does this, but shady operators exist.

Can Legit Live Casinos Use Fake Players?

The truth is that regulated casinos can’t afford to risk it. They operate under strict oversight from gaming authorities like the UKGC and Curacao Gambling Board.

When players catch them using fake players it’s a scandal. The licensing board will annul their gaming license leaving their reputation in tatters.

Moreover, they enforce independent testing through fair play. RNG audits guarantee the veracity of each spin and unpredictable outcomes.

How Live Dealer Casinos Influence Action Without Fake Players

Casinos don’t need fake players to control the action. The game can shift dramatically just by how real players bet.

High-rollers are the biggest influencers. When someone bets thousands per hand, the energy at the table changes. Other players start following their lead, thinking they must know something.

Casinos are experts at making the game feel exciting and unpredictable. But that doesn’t mean they’re using fake players. They don’t have to—real gamblers drive the action.

Can Online Casinos Use Winning Streaks to Benefit Them?

Casinos use winning streaks for marketing. I’ve seen them showcase huge payouts to attract more players.
If someone wins on a live dealer game, the casino might highlight it on their website or social media.

“Seeing others win makes people want to play. Players who don’t understand ‘the house always wins’
believe a losing streak is proof of rigging.”

I get it—busting five hands in a row feels unfair. That’s how probability works. Over thousands of hands,
the house edge plays out exactly as it should. The casino doesn’t need to cheat; the math already favors them.

Do High Rollers Have an Impact?

One real tactic that can blur the lines is VIP influencers. Some high rollers get special deals from casinos.

They might receive exclusive bonuses, cash-back offers, or comped losses. Casinos know that when VIPs play big,
others will follow.

Casinos use every psychological trick in the book, but that doesn’t mean they’re faking players.

Tips to Protect Yourself from Unfair Live Casinos

Before I deposit a cent, I check if it has a license. I visit sites like Trustpilot or Casinomeister to read the reviews from other players.

When many players report rigged games, slow payouts, or account closures, those are warning signs. A single complaint doesn’t prove much. When I see the same issues pop up something’s wrong.

Live dealer games feel safest when there’s a high player volume. More real bettors at the table make it harder for casinos to manipulate results.

If I see empty or low-traffic live tables I think twice before joining. I prefer casinos with active players, fair limits, and a history of fast payouts.

Most importantly, I test the withdrawal process early. If I win, I request a withdrawal right away. If the casino delays, asks for excessive documents or ignores my request, I know I’m dealing with a shady operator.
